SHELVES
Quick Space Shelf Slide-Out Spillproof Shelf (on some models)
This shelf splits in half
and slides under itself
for storage of tall items
on the shelf below.
The slide-out shelf allows you to reach
items stored behind others. The special
edges are designed to help prevent
spills from dripping to lower shelves.
Make sure you push the shelves all the
way back in before you close the door.
How to Rearrange Your Shelves
and Freezer Baskets
Glass and wire shelves are adjustable. This allows you to move the
shelves around to fit your family’s food storage needs.
To remove shelves:
Tilt the shelf up at front, then
lift it up and out of the tracks
on the rear wall.
To relocate shelves:
Select desired shelf height. With
shelf front raised slightly, engage
the top hooks in the tracks at the
rear of the cabinet. Then lower
the front of the shelf until it
locks into position.
Wire slide-out freezer baskets can
be relocated in the same way.
Bins on Fresh Food Compartment Door
(on some models)
Adjustable bins can easily be carried from refrigerator to work area.
To remove:
Tilt the bin up and pull out on the molded
supports until it comes completely out of
the door.
To replace or relocate:
Select desired shelf height, engage the
bin in the molded supports of the door
and slide the bin in. The bin will hook
in place.
The divider (on some models) helps
prevent tipping, spilling or sliding of
small items stored on the door shelf.
Place index finger and middle finger
on either side of the divider near the
front and simply move it back and
forth to fit your needs.
To remove fixed bins, first remove
the food in the bins. Then, grasping the
bin at each end, push in at the bottom
as you lift and pull out at the top.
